Noteworthy Medical Systems to Acquire ChartConnect
CLEVELAND, OH and YAKIMA, WA (Aug. 18, 2008)—Noteworthy Medical Systems, originator of the market's only three-screen ambulatory electronic health record (EHR), announced today that it is acquiring strategic partner ChartConnect, Inc. ChartConnect's web-based applications facilitate communication between care providers and securely allow the exchange and transfer of clinical information between care providers and the various parties who support the provision of care in a community, i.e., laboratories, radiology departments, pharmacies, hospitals, transcription services, etc.
The new company will retain the name Noteworthy Medical Systems and will serve a combined customer base of more than 1,200 practices, 5,700 healthcare providers and 12,000 users across 43 states, with company locations in Cleveland, Ohio; Phoenix, Arizona; Yakima, Washington; and Pocatello, Idaho.
The ChartConnect acquisition follows on the heels of Noteworthy's acquisition of MARS Medical Systems, Inc. (see press release dated August 5, 2008), where Noteworthy acquired one of the most sophisticated web-based practice management applications on the market. Given the MARS and ChartConnect acquisitions, Noteworthy now has a complete application suite to support both the administrative and clinical workflows for ambulatory care in a physician's office, a multi-specialty clinic, or more importantly, ambulatory care for an entire community of providers. ChartConnect currently has 18 communities where its medical hub and community health record are deployed along with other applications. Several of these communities have an 85% provider participation rate.
